Description:

Support the team’s efforts in effectively addressing clients’ borrowing needs in debt capital markets by being involved in the pricing and syndication strategy for all relevant transactions

Contribute to monitoring and managing the execution of bond mandates (including close co-operation with distribution teams, under the supervision of senior team members). The primary duty of care of syndicate is to the borrower, yet the transactor should make sure that investors are treated fairly in this process

Support the team’s efforts in developing and maintaining a track record of winning and executing bond mandates

Involve in the development of advisory and product offering in line with the business’ strategy and priorities

Involve in the development of the client base in line with Global Finance’s and SG Group’s strategy and priorities

To support the team in internal dialogues with colleagues, notably regional/product heads in Debt Capital Market and bankers
